ATMI Life Science's Nucleo single-use bioreactors have a cube-shaped
bag instead of a cylindrical bag, a tumbling (Pad-Drive) mixing system
instead of a rotating impeller, and a dynamic sparging arrangement in
place of a static structure and is available in 50 L and 1,000 L volumes
(ATMI http://www.atmi-lifesciences.com ) .
Integrity™ PadReactor™
The Integrity™ PadReactor™ system is a single-use bioreactor specifically
designed to fulfill the needs of cell culturists. It is perfectly suited to labo-
ratory environments, process development centers, clinical material supply,
and flexible GMP manufacturing. The PadReactor offers an open architec-
ture controller platform, which gives the end-user the opportunity to choose
a preferred controller or use an existing control system.
The bioreactor vessel, which offers comparable functionality to classical
stirred-tank bioreactors, is a single-use bag integrating an internal paddle
mixing and sparger system. This innovative bag design allows a noninvasive
connection to the system. The paddle is enclosed in a medical-grade ultra
low density polyethylene (ULDPE) sleeve made from the same contact mate-
rial as the bag itself, and is coupled on top of the vessel with the mechanical
mixing head.
As with all ATMI LifeSciences' single-use systems, the Integrity PadReactor
utilizes disposable mixing bags made from TK8 bioprocess film. The prod-
uct-contacting layer of TK8 film is blow-extruded in-house by ATMI under
cleanroom conditions using medical-grade ultralow-density polyethylene
resin. It is then laminated to create a gas barrier film of exceptional cleanli-
ness, strength, and clarity that is animal-derived component free (ADCF)
and complies fully with USP Class VI requirements.
The Integrity PadReactor single-use bioreactor consists of the following:
Drive unit: The flexible drive unit allows the system to cultivate cells in
disposable bags. One drive unit can allow the user to mix in multiple
disposable mixing bags of various sizes. Each system comes with the
appropriate mixing stick for your container.
Mobile retaining tank: The purpose of the retaining tank is to support
the mixing bag and provide mobility before and after the operation.
Various tank sizes and options are available.
Bioreactor vessel: The reactor vessel uses an innovative bag design that
allows a noninvasive connection to the mixer. Mixing is achieved
when the integrated paddle/sparger inside the bag rotates within
the bag.
